If you are ever in Des Moines, check out the Habitat for Humanity Restore.
We have bought stoves, dishwashers, lamps,hoods, floor tile, some paint, doors, countertops. Just know what you need size wise before going. Our understanding is the Home Depots, Lowes,and etc., give the floor models to them because they aren’t allowed to sell if a charity is in the area. Dishwasher was missing the owners manual, pulled one off the Maytag website. Lamps came from the Downtown Marriott remodeling.
